Introduction
Recent polling data shows that the race for the U.S. Senate in Texas is becoming more competitive. Currently, Democratic candidate James Talarico holds a small lead over the Republican nominee, Ken Paxton.

Main Body
Recent data from the Siena Research Institute and Reconnaissance Market Research shows that James Talarico has a 3-point lead, with 47 percent support compared to Ken Paxton's 44 percent. Talarico is particularly strong among independent voters (52 percent to 34 percent) and Latino voters (51 percent to 41 percent). In contrast, the race for governor is more stable, as Governor Greg Abbott maintains a 5-point lead over Gina Hinojosa. This suggests that some voters may choose candidates from different parties for different offices.

Democrats believe they can win because President Trump's approval rating is falling, especially among Hispanic voters, due to economic problems and tensions with Iran. Furthermore, Ken Paxton faces several challenges. Although he was acquitted by the Senate after being impeached in 2023, his legal history has led to a high unfavorability rating of 54 percent. Interestingly, Dan Cogdell, who once defended Paxton, has now endorsed Talarico. Meanwhile, Republicans are trying to describe Talarico as too extreme by focusing on his views on religion and lifestyle.

Conclusion
Although polls show a close race for the Senate seat, prediction markets still suggest a Republican victory, showing a difference between current public opinion and expected results.

Vocabulary Learning
⚡ The 'Contrast Shift': Moving from A2 to B2
At the A2 level, we usually connect ideas with simple words like but or and. To reach B2, you need to use Contrast Connectors to show a sophisticated relationship between two different facts.
Look at how the text handles opposing ideas:
*"In contrast, the race for governor is more stable..." "Although he was acquitted... his legal history has led to a high unfavorability rating."
🛠️ How to use these tools
1. The 'Although' Pivot (The Subordinator) Instead of saying: "He won the case. But people still dislike him," (A2 style), use Although to create one complex sentence:
- Formula:
Although + [Fact A], [Opposite Fact B] - Example: "Although the polls are close, prediction markets expect a Republican win."
2. The 'In Contrast' Bridge (The Transition) Use this when you have finished one thought and want to start a new paragraph or sentence that shows a complete opposite.
- Example: "Talarico is winning with Latino voters. In contrast, the governor's race is not as competitive."
